Show 1900.] MAMMALS FROM SIAM. 195 18. Mus CONCOLOR Blyth. Doi Sritepe, Chingmai. a-d. d- 3rd & 25th March and 30th April. 19. RHIZOMYS MINOR Gray. Nan. a. 2 » young but full-grown. 8th Aug., 1897. Dimensions: head and body 213 mm.; tail 50 ; hind foot 26; ear 10. b. 2 imm. sk. 18th Aug., 1897. Dimensions: head and body 160 mm.; tail 45 ; hind foot 25 ; ear 7. c. 2 imm. sk. 18th Sept., 1897. Dimensions: head and body 159 m m ; tail 52 ; hind foot 27 ; ear 8. I have examined two specimens, now in the Museum, with which the above-mentioned specimens closely agree. One of these two specimens must have been Gray's type. One was procured in Cochin China, and the other by Dr. Finlayson in Siam. They differ in the intensity of the umber-brown tips to the hairs, the Siamese specimen showing considerably more than that from Cochin China. None of Mr. Lyle's specimens are fully adult, and though they vary slightly among themselves, show, as might be expected, a much greater affinity to the Siamese specimen. Mr. Thomas notes1 that the bright colour is only assumed in adult individuals; and as Mr. Lyle's specimens are all young, I was at first inclined to regard R. minor as an immature R. baclius. The skull2, however, of the Cochin China specimen is fully adult and is much smaller than the type skull of R. baclius. The skull of Mr. Lyle's largest specimen, except in being that of a younger animal, agrees in all respects with the skull from Cochin China. R. minor is therefore a southern race of R. baclius inhabiting Siam and Cochin China, and is distinguishable chiefly by its smaller size and slightly duller colour. The measurements of Mr. Lyle's largest specimen given above represent the average size of this species. The measurements of R. baclius as given by Blanford are as follows :-Head and body 228 ram. ; tail 68 : hind foot 31. 20. MANIS JAVANICA Desm. Nan. a.
